Executive Assistant to Lead Pastor

Vizion Church, Charlotte, North Carolina, United States, 28245

Save Job

The Executive Assistant to the Lead Pastor provides high-level administrative and organizational support to senior executives, managing complex calendars, travel, communications (emails, calls), meetings, and projects, and handling confidential information with discretion to maximize executive efficiency and productivity. Core duties include scheduling, travel coordination, document preparation, report management, and serving as a key liaison for internal and external stakeholders.

CORE RESPONSIBILITIES 1. Calendar & Email Management

Steward the Lead Pastor’s email inbox daily, responding to inquiries with clarity, grace, and timeliness.

Serve as a warm, hospitable point of contact and direct inquiries to the appropriate team member

Maintain clear documentation and prioritize urgent or sensitive requests, ensuring prompt follow up and care.

2. Communication & Access Control

Manage communication from Lead Pastor to Direct Reports, Elder Board, Overseer Board, staff and congregation.

Act as a decision filter: resolve issues independently whenever possible and bring only high-impact, leadership-level decisions to the Lead Pastor.

Present options and recommendations when decisions must be escalated.

Manage Lead Pastor’s calendar in a way that allows for margin - permitting ample time to accomplish tasks/ responsibilities.

3. Logistics & Travel

Create & arrange detailed travel itineraries including flights, hotels, transportation, etc…

Coordinate guest speaking details both inbound and outbound (when Lead Pastor travels or when Guest Speakers are invited to Vizion Church)

Book flights and lodging accommodations.

4. Document & Data Preparation

Prepare reports / agendas / presentations / spreadsheets upon request

Maintain organized database of pertinent information and documents

Proofread documents / presentations

Capture minutes and disseminate to correct parties immediately following meetings

Maintain record of action items both for Lead Pastor and assigned by Lead Pastor to ensure tasks / responsibilities are progressing to completion in a timely manner.

5. Ministry & Personal Support

Assist with pastoral care requests.

Assist with errands / projects

Provide on-site support during Sunday services, assisting with needs as they arise.

6. Meeting & Event Coordination

Oversee meeting logistics ensuring a professional, organized environment

Organize internal / external meetings

Book / reserve spaces

8. Project Support & Management

Oversee special projects when assigned by Lead Pastor

Manage timelines, communication, minutes and action items

Work alongside Lead Pastor to ensure the implementation of special projects
